Protein Popcorn Slice


Makes: 16 slicesCalories: 165Difficulty Level: ModeratePreparation time: 10 minutesCook time: 0 minutesTotal time: 10 minutes
Ingredients
- 2 scoops (60g) Bulk Nutrients WPI, WPC, Protein Matrix+ or Thermowhey in Chocolate
- 70g popped popcorn
- 200g chocolate – melted
- 30ml coconut oil
- 60g almond spread
- 80g shredded coconut
- 1 teaspoon of zero/low-calorie sweetener
- Pinch of salt
Instructions
- Step 1: Line an 8 x 8 inch baking tin with paper.
- Step 2: Pop the popcorn if required.
- Step 3: Melt the chocolate and coconut oil together on 30 second intervals using the microwave.
- Step 4: Once melted, stir in the almond spread.
- Step 5: Combine popcorn, protein powder and coconut in a separate bowl.
- Step 6: Pour over chocolate mix and stir until well coated and mixed.
- Step 7: Press into the lined tin. You may need to apply some pressure.
- Step 8: Place in the fridge to set.
- Step 9: Break up or slice once set.
- Step 10: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 5 days.
